Manufacturing Quality Covers: Polymer and Metal Choices
Identifying best sheltering enclosure for industrial equipment is vital for ensuring its lasting capacity and safety in challenging environments. Generally, options fall into two main categories: plastic and metal. Plastic enclosures, often constructed from materials like polycarbonate or fiberglass, offer exceptional corrosion resistance, are relatively easy-to-move, and can be budget-friendly for many applications. However, metal enclosures, most commonly aluminum or stainless steel, provide enhanced hardness, climatic dissipation, and improved shielding against electromagnetic interference (EMI). The best choice relies on factors such as the utilization conditions, the equipment's amperage requirements, and the overall budget. Ultimately, a thorough inspection of these considerations will lead to the ideal enclosure option for your specific requisites.
